javascript - Firebase 顺序按降序排列

标签 javascript jquery angularjs firebase

我在 Firebase 中有一个数组,我得到的结果如下:

var ref = new Firebase(url);
ref.orderByChild("date").on("child_added", function(obj) {
    console.log(obj.val());
});

但我需要按降序排列。我如何使用 Firebase 做到这一点?

谢谢!

最佳答案

由于您添加了 AngularJS 标签,我假设您在项目中使用 Angular。在这种情况下,使用 AngularFire (http://angularfire.com) 会让您的生活变得更加轻松。

使用 AngularFire 后,您可以使用 $firebaseArray 服务从数据库中获取数组,并像对任何其他数组一样对其进行排序。

$firebaseArray 文档可以在这里找到:https://www.firebase.com/docs/web/libraries/angular/guide/synchronized-arrays.html

关于javascript - Firebase 顺序按降序排列,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/32528504/

相关文章:

angularjs - 如何在AngularJS中将数据从一个html页面传递到另一个页面?

javascript - View |如何将Web端口号更改为80?

javascript - javascript 中特殊字符的 String.fromCharCode 问题

javascript - 将变量放入 css 按钮的 href 属性

javascript - 使用 javascript 或 jquery 更改元素值后更改 angular2 组件模型

javascript - 在 MongoDB 中查找所有具有相关 objectId 名称的内容

javascript - 使用 ng-repeat AngularJs 显示数据

javascript - 我正在使用 javascript 提交表单,但我无法在 php 页面中获取值

jQuery 非选择器似乎不适用于类

javascript - jquery 验证接受方法 - TypeError : Cannot read property 'call' of undefined